DCOM下跨平台数据访问的性能优化与可靠性分析.pptx

DCOM下跨平台数据访问的性能优化与可靠性分析.pptx

  1. 1、本文档共30页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

DCOM下跨平台数据访问的性能优化与可靠性分析

分布式对象通信下的性能优化策略

COM接口跨平台调用效率分析

DCOM数据访问可靠性优化方法

COM+事务处理跨平台可靠性探究

跨平台数据访问异常处理机制

DCOM数据访问性能监控指标

跨平台数据访问安全策略分析

DCOM数据访问性能调优实践ContentsPage目录页

分布式对象通信下的性能优化策略DCOM下跨平台数据访问的性能优化与可靠性分析

分布式对象通信下的性能优化策略分布式对象通信与数据访问1.分布式对象通信(DCOM)是微软公司推出的一种跨平台、跨网络的分布式技术,为开发分布式应用程序提供了便捷的方式。DCOM下跨平台数据访问时,需要考虑数据访问延迟、网络带宽、可靠性等因素,以确保数据访问的高效、可靠。2.DCOM访问数据库的性能优化:DCOM通过远程过程调用(RPC)机制在分布式系统中进行数据访问,RPC的开销可能会对性能产生一定影响。为了优化DCOM访问数据库的性能,可以采用以下策略:①使用连接池:连接池可以减少创建和销毁数据库连接的开销,提高数据库访问的效率。②使用事务:事务可以确保数据库操作的原子性和一致性,避免数据的不一致。③使用缓存:缓存可以减少对数据库的访问次数,提高数据访问的性能。④使用异步操作:异步操作可以减少DCOM调用对应用程序主线程的阻塞,提高应用程序的响应速度。

分布式对象通信下的性能优化策略数据传输机制优化1.数据压缩与解压:由于网络传输的瓶颈往往在于网络带宽,因此对数据进行压缩可以减少传输的数据量,从而提高数据传输的效率。2.数据加密与解密:在分布式系统中,数据安全性是非常重要的。数据加密可以防止数据在传输过程中被窃取或篡改。3.流数据传输:对于大数据量的传输,可以使用流数据传输的方式。流数据传输可以将数据分成多个块,逐块传输,从而减少网络拥塞的风险,提高数据传输的可靠性。网络优化策略1.选择合适的网络拓扑结构:网络拓扑结构对网络性能有很大的影响。常见的网络拓扑结构有星形拓扑、总线拓扑、环形拓扑等。在选择网络拓扑结构时,需要考虑网络规模、网络成本、网络可靠性等因素。2.选择合适的网络协议:网络协议是网络通信的基础。常见的网络协议有TCP/IP协议、UDP协议、HTTP协议等。在选择网络协议时,需要考虑网络应用的类型、网络带宽、网络可靠性等因素。3.网络负载均衡:网络负载均衡可以将网络流量平均分配到多台服务器上,从而减轻服务器的负载,提高网络的吞吐量和可靠性。

分布式对象通信下的性能优化策略可靠性优化策略1.容错机制:容错机制可以检测和处理系统中的故障,从而确保系统的可靠性。常见的容错机制有故障转移、故障恢复、故障掩盖等。2.冗余机制:冗余机制是在系统中设置备份,以便在出现故障时能够及时进行切换,从而确保系统的可靠性。常见的冗余机制有热备份、冷备份、异地备份等。3.监控与报警机制:监控与报警机制可以实时监控系统的运行状态,并在出现故障时及时发出报警,以便运维人员及时处理故障,从而确保系统的可靠性。跨平台数据访问1.异构数据源支持:跨平台数据访问需要支持异构数据源,即能够访问不同类型、不同平台、不同数据库的数据源。2.数据集成与共享:跨平台数据访问需要实现数据集成与共享,即能够将来自不同数据源的数据进行整合,并能够让不同的应用程序访问这些数据。3.数据一致性保证:跨平台数据访问需要保证数据的一致性,即确保不同数据源中的数据保持一致,避免数据不一致的情况发生。

COM接口跨平台调用效率分析DCOM下跨平台数据访问的性能优化与可靠性分析

COM接口跨平台调用效率分析COM接口跨平台调用性能影响因素,1.跨平台数据类型映射的复杂性:COM接口中的数据类型可能与其他平台的数据类型不同,需要进行复杂的数据类型映射,这可能会导致性能开销。2.跨平台网络通信延迟:COM接口跨平台调用涉及到网络通信,网络通信延迟可能会对性能产生较大影响。3.跨平台操作系统兼容性:COM接口跨平台调用涉及到不同平台的操作系统,操作系统之间的兼容性可能会对性能产生影响。COM接口跨平台调用优化方法,1.使用高效的数据类型映射技术:可以采用高效的数据类型映射技术来减少数据类型映射的性能开销,例如使用二进制数据传输协议等。2.优化网络通信协议:可以优化网络通信协议来降低网络通信延迟,例如使用更快的网络协议等。3.提高操作系统兼容性:可以提高操作系统兼容性来减少操作系统之间的兼容性问题,例如使用跨平台操作系统等。

COM接口跨平台调用效率分析COM接口跨平台调用可靠性影响因素,1.跨平台网络通信可靠性:COM接口跨平台调用涉及到网络通信,网络通信可靠性可能会对可靠性产生较大影响。2.跨平台操

文档评论(0)

智慧IT + 关注
实名认证
内容提供者

微软售前技术专家持证人

生命在于奋斗,技术在于分享!

领域认证该用户于2023年09月10日上传了微软售前技术专家

1亿VIP精品文档

相关文档